Editorial note
The Sony Cybershot DSC-P72 stands out for its exceptional image quality, thanks to the brand's advanced technology. The photos are sharp and vibrant, offering a pleasant visual experience. Its compact and lightweight design makes it easy to carry, making it an ideal choice for travel. The user interface, while generally intuitive, may seem slightly complicated for beginners. However, it is important to note some limitations. The image quality may be inferior to that of newer models, particularly in low-light conditions. Additionally, the lack of Wi-Fi or Bluetooth connectivity limits the quick sharing of photos on social media, which can be a drawback for modern users. The battery also has a relatively short lifespan, requiring frequent recharges during intensive use. Despite these drawbacks, the value for money is satisfactory, especially for those looking for a reliable device from the Sony brand. The included user manual is a plus, providing tips and tricks to optimize the use of the device. In summary, the Sony Cybershot DSC-P72 is a solid choice for photography enthusiasts who prioritize quality and reliability.Score details
